Cliffcrest Neighbourhood Overview

Amidst the vibrant province of Ontario, Canada, the distinctive neighbourhood of Cliffcrest stands tall within Toronto. Its origins can be traced to the 1960s, amidst the peak of Toronto's urban development. Situated along the shores of Lake Ontario in the district of Scarborough, Cliffcrest is bordered by neighbourhoods such as Midland Avenue, the Canadian National Railway, and Bellamy Road. It was named to reference the Scarborough Bluffs landscape that forms the neighbourhood's southern boundary. Over time, Cliffcrest's identity solidified to create a unique blend of urban convenience and residential charm. The neighbourhoods attract a more diverse demographic and house relatively more affluent residents who seek a quieter lifestyle. People and Culture of Cliffcrest Toronto

Cliffcrest is home to various people, too; let's shed some light on what kind of people live here! Cliffcrest has approximately 13500 residents, of which the gender ratio is an even 50-50. While married couples comprise 71% of the neighbourhood, 50% of the families here have children at home. Of these 13500 residents, 5.48% are of Chinese descent, 7.17% are of African descent, and 22.56% of the population is South Asian. Despite the multi-continental linguistic diversity, 90.6% of the residents prefer to speak English as their first language, and 0.1% choose French.
Statistic Cliffcrest Toronto Ontario
Population 13,583 3,013,752 14,804,681
Speak English only 90.6% 85.9% 86.1%
Speak French only 0.1% 0.1% 0.3%
To touch upon the employment stability in the neighbourhood, Cliffcrest boasts 9% higher than the national average median household income and 8% lower than the national average unemployment rate. While 62.9% of working residents are in the labour force, 40% of the population earns between $60,000 and $150,000; it's safe to say that this paints a financially stable and secure picture of the neighbourhood.
Index Cliffcrest Toronto Ontario
Median household income $89,634 $81,376 $87,353
Unemployment rate 5.9% 4.8% 4.2%
In labour force 62.9% 65.5% 61.7%

CN Towers

One of the most recognizable pieces of architecture in the Toronto Skyline, just 29 minutes away, is the CN Tower. As the tallest freestanding structure in the Western Hemisphere, it soars into the sky at 553 meters high. CN Tower is a great tourist attraction, featuring 147 floors, of which the Lower Observation Level features a glass floor from where you will end up gaping at the beautiful city. It also features an award-winning revolving eatery with panoramic views.

Casa Loma

The Gothic Revival castle-style mansion and garden in midtown Toronto, the Grand Casa Loma, established in 1914, features regular tours and gardens that are open seasonally. Riddled with fortifications and numerous secret passageways, it pays homage to the castles and knights of days gone by. As of date, it is recognized as one of the few true castles in North America and is just 35 minutes away from Cliffcrest.

Scarboro Crescent Park

This clifftop park is a sight to behold and very popular for its multiple amenities. The park offers breathtaking views of Lake Ontario and Scarborough Bluffs. Along with a playground, splash pad, and four tennis courts, the park is situated high above the ground and is a serene spot to enjoy sunrise and sunset views. This outdoor treasure is just 12 minutes away from the centre of Cliffcrest.

Average Cost of Living in Cliffcrest

Measured in a normalised index, the average cost of living in Cliffcrest, Toronto, is 111, 10% higher than the national average. The goods and services are 8% higher than the national average, and the housing in this neighbourhood is 14% higher than the national average.
Index Cliffcrest
Cost of living 111
Goods & Services 108
Groceries 100
Health care 103
Housing 114
Transportation 107
Utilities 130

Real Estate Housing Market of Cliffcrest

Cliffcrest, Toronto, offers a divеrsе rangе of rеal еstatе opportunitiеs. For property on sale, prices typically average $630,909 for a condo apartment, $800,004 for a condo townhouse, and an average of $1,846,797 for a detached house.
